Title:Regulatory discretion and the unofficial economy
Journal:American Economic Review
1998 : MAY, VOL. 88:2, p. 387-392

Abstract:Politicization of economic activity means the exercise of control rights over firms by politicians and bureaucrats. In most countries politicians maintain property rights in firms, typically in the form of residual control rights as defined by Sanford Grossman and Oliver Hart (1986). These control rights may have served an ideological agenda in the past, but they are often used to further the private agenda of politicians and bureaucrats. How widespread are these rights and how damaging are their effects around the world?
